description This paper focuses on the concept of S c-open sets as a generalization of classical c-open sets in topology. The reason behind introducing S c-open sets is to overcome the limitations of traditional open sets in handling uncertainty and vagueness prevalent in decision-making processes. Moreover, the paper makes significant contributions to the discussion of the concepts of soft topological spaces (STS ) by utilizing S c-open sets that investigate the theoretical foundations and mathematical properties of S c-open sets, exploring their relationships with other soft open sets and soft topological concepts. Overall, the paper aims to provide a comprehensive understanding of STS and their properties and theorems utilizing the concept of S c-open set and explores the theoretical foundations, mathematical properties, and relationships of these sets while extending their application to domains such as S c-continuity, S c-separation axiom and S c compactness.
